Choosing The Right Fibromyalgia Treatment Center


By Essie Osborn


Anyone that is focused on the idea of trying to overcome various health risks is known to deal with various complications along the way. Many people find that dealing with chronic conditions can often require the use of specifically trained professionals and facilities as their primary physicians are unable to offer the guidance they need. Anyone focused on this particular need should know the basics of choosing the right fibromyalgia treatment center to ensure they receive the guidance they need.

Fibromyalgia is associated with chronic pains that are the result of the nerve endings continually sending erroneous signals to the brain. People that are dealing with this condition often discover that their primary care doctors are unequipped to offer effective solutions as there is little known about how to provide the best solutions. The decisions completed from the multitude of specialty care centers are often quite difficult to complete.

Consumers in Toledo, OH are equipped to sort through a vast array of facilities to focus on when making this decision. Most people are not clear about what factors are the most productive to filter through when considering all that is needed. Making the right decision is usually quite easy when several considerations are specifically filtered through.

People should initially make sure they carefully consider any referrals that are offered to them from their primary care doctor. Referrals are often a significant factor in this process as they are usually provided when patients discuss their issues and are then encouraged to utilize specialty options for a full recovery process. People are able to feel much more confident as a result of using this information.

Consumers should also consider any requirements that must be met for receiving care from the facility. Many specialty professionals and facilities require that patients be within a specific age and gender bracket or have a particular stage of their condition as part of being able to participate in their programs. Most facilities make this information well known to ensure consumers are actually able to make an informed choice.

Consumers also tend to focus on the chance to make sure the facility is easily accessed and utilized. Taking time away from everyday life can be difficult for people when trying to receive care which can be even more challenging when working through chronic pain. Closely located facilities that are also available for extended appointment options help consumers receive the best guidance.

The kinds of treatment that patients are able to receive should be specifically weighted as well. A majority of facilities are only equipped to offer care for various forms of the condition due to the knowledge of their employees and expansiveness of their equipment. Consumers are focused on the facilities that offer the most extensive provisions to be certain their issues will be fully resolved.

Potential patients are also worried about pricing when making this choice. People with medical coverage should be able to gain full access to benefits while those without insurance are encouraged to focus on low cost of care with flexible payment options. Concentrating on the most affordable facilities is helpful in preventing missed opportunities for recovery.
